Information on Subaru Engines - By: Mady John

The EJ Subaru engine is a succession of car engines produced by Subaru and launched in the year 1989; projected to get ahead of the previous EA Subaru engine. The EJ Subaru Engines series is the main stay of Subaru engine line; with all Subaru engines of this line being 16 valve flat 4 horizontal with configurations available for single or double over-head camshaft arrangement (DOHC or SOHC). Logically articulated and turbocharged types are available; ranging from about 120 horse power in early non turbo Legacies to 320 horsepower in the Impreza WRX STI. EJ22 Subaru Engines Enhancements and Improvements
• The Subaru engines and transmissions are secured with 6 bolts and 2 studs.

• The Subaru Engine thrust bearing have been moved to No. 5 position.

• The Subaru Engine oil groove in the No. 1 and No. 3 has been altered to give added lubrication to crank Journal.
